Why Allen's Climate is Tough on Air Conditioners
Living in Allen means your cooling system works exceptionally hard for a significant portion of the year. Summer temperatures consistently soar into the mid-90s and frequently exceed 100°F, coupled with high humidity levels. This creates a punishing environment for HVAC equipment. Systems must run for extended periods under high pressure, accelerating wear on components like capacitors, contactors, and compressors. Furthermore, the region's expansive clay soil is prone to shifting, which can affect the stability and leveling of outdoor condenser units over time, potentially leading to strain on refrigerant lines and connections. Understanding these environmental stressors is the first step in proactive maintenance and recognizing when your system needs attention.
Most Common Air Conditioning Problems in Allen Homes
Based on local service data, several issues recur with high frequency during the cooling season. Being able to identify these can help you describe the problem more accurately to a technician.
- Refrigerant Leaks: The high-pressure operation required to combat extreme heat can exacerbate small weaknesses in the refrigerant circuit, leading to leaks. Symptoms include reduced cooling capacity, ice buildup on the evaporator coil, and higher electricity bills.
- Frozen Evaporator Coils: This is often a symptom of another problem, such as low refrigerant, a severely clogged air filter, or failing blower motors that restrict airflow. When airflow is blocked, the coil gets too cold and freezes, completely halting cooling.
- Electrical Component Failure: Capacitors (which help motors start and run) and contactors (electrical relays) are particularly vulnerable to Allen's heat. They can fail suddenly, often during the initial startup of a very hot day, leaving you with a system that hums but won't start.
- Clogged Condensate Drain Lines: High humidity means your AC produces a lot of condensation. This moisture travels through a drain line, where algae and mold can grow, creating a clog. A full drain pan will trigger a safety switch that shuts off the AC to prevent water damage.
- Debris on Condenser Coils: The outdoor unit can become clogged with cottonwood seeds, pollen, grass clippings, and general dust. This "blanket" of debris insulates the coil, preventing it from releasing heat and causing the system to overwork and lose efficiency.
- Short Cycling: This is when your AC turns on and off every few minutes, never completing a full cooling cycle. It can be caused by an oversized unit, a malfunctioning thermostat, or a refrigerant issue 1. Short cycling causes excessive wear and dramatically reduces energy efficiency.
The Professional Repair Process: What to Expect
When you call a professional for AC service in Allen, a skilled technician will typically follow a systematic diagnostic and repair process to ensure a thorough fix.
- Initial Inspection & Triage: The technician will start with a visual and auditory check, looking for obvious signs like ice on refrigerant lines, water pooling, unusual noises (grinding, hissing, or banging), or burning odors 2.
- Comprehensive Diagnostic Testing: This is the core of the service. Using specialized tools, the tech will measure system pressures and temperatures to check refrigerant charge, assess the temperature split between return and supply air, check electrical amperage on motors, and measure airflow velocity 3.
- Targeted Problem Identification: Based on diagnostics, the technician pinpoints the issue. This may involve using an electronic leak detector to find refrigerant leaks or a multimeter to test capacitors, contactors, and windings in motors for continuity and proper microfarad ratings 4 5.
- Repair Execution: Once the problem is identified, the technician will explain the issue and provide a repair estimate. Repairs can range from quick component swaps (like a capacitor) to more involved tasks like sealing a leak, replacing a motor, or cleaning a completely clogged drain line with a vacuum or pressurized flush 6 7.
- System Verification: After the repair, the technician will restart the system, verify proper operation, and ensure all safety controls are functioning. They should also provide guidance on preventing a recurrence.
Service Logistics in the Allen Area
Knowing what's available can help you plan during a breakdown.
- Emergency Service: Due to the critical nature of AC failure in summer, many local HVAC companies offer 24/7 emergency service, with some guaranteeing a 2-hour response window during peak heatwaves 8 9.
- Standard Service Calls: For non-emergencies, you can often expect a technician to perform diagnostics within about 60 minutes of arrival, though repair time will vary based on the issue and part availability 10.
- Peak Season Demand: The busiest period is from June through August, especially during the first sustained heatwave of the season 11. Scheduling maintenance in the spring or repairs as soon as you notice a minor issue can help you avoid longer wait times.

Understanding Repair Costs in Allen
Repair costs in Allen are generally reflective of the broader North Texas market, which is considered competitive with balanced pricing for labor, typically ranging from $110 to $135 per hour. However, specific repair costs are driven by the part and labor required. Here's a general overview of common repair price ranges in the region 12 13:
- Diagnostic/Service Fee: $89 - $100+ (This fee is often applied to the total repair cost if you proceed with the work.)
- Capacitor Replacement: $180 - $380
- Contactor Replacement: $200 - $420
- Refrigerant Recharge & Leak Repair: $350 - $1,500+ (Highly variable based on leak location and refrigerant type)
- Blower Motor Replacement: $520 - $1,200
- Compressor Replacement: $2,200 - $4,800 (often leads homeowners to consider system replacement)
- Emergency/After-Hours Fee: An additional $150 - $250 may be added to the standard rates for service outside normal business hours 14 15.
Proactive Maintenance to Avoid Repairs
A little preventative care can go a long way in avoiding the most common breakdowns.
- Change Air Filters Monthly: This is the single most important task for Allen homeowners, especially during high-use seasons. A clean filter maintains proper airflow, preventing frozen coils and system strain.
- Clean Outdoor Condenser Coils: At least once a year, preferably in the spring, turn off the power to the outdoor unit and gently hose down the coils to remove built-up pollen, seeds, and dirt 16 17.
- Maintain Clearance: Ensure there is at least 2 feet of clear space around your outdoor condenser unit. Trim back any shrubs, vines, or grass that could restrict airflow 18.
- Schedule Annual Professional Maintenance: A pre-season tune-up by a qualified technician can catch small issues like weak capacitors, minor leaks, or drain line algae before they lead to a full failure during a heatwave.
